bullet  General Notes:

Joseph, brother to Daniel, sailed on the HERCULES, on or about 31 Mar 1634,
approximately a week after Daniel sailed on the MARY & JOHN. Joseph took his oath of allegiance on 24 Mar 1633/34, also. [1633 under old calendar; 1634 under new calendar] He was to have sailed with Daniel on the MARY & JOHN but remained behind to look after their chattel. Little is known about Joseph LADD between this date and 1644 when his name first appeared on a deed of John ANTHONY, Portsmouth, RI. (New England Historical Genealogy Register, Vol. 9, pg. 267) [paraphrased!]

From Warren Ladd's book, p. 288: "We think it is evident, though there is no positive proof, that this Joseph Ladd was a younger brother of Daniel Ladd, who came from London in the Mary and John in 1633. The reason for this belief is the fact that John Anthony, whose deed of land to Richard Tew in 1644 Joseph Ladd was a witness, took the oath of Supremacy and Allegiance to pass to New England in the Mary and John, Robert Sayres master, 24th of March, 1633, but "stayed over to oversee the chattle," and came in the Hercules, John Kidder master, which sailed a week later than the Mary and John, in which Daniel Ladd came. [See New England Historical and Genealogical Register, vol. 9, page 267.] John Anthony settled at Portsmouth. R. I. Joseph Ladd lived at Portsmouth, R. I. The inference is that Joseph Ladd, a minor, lived in the family of John Anthony, was a relative of Mr. Anthony or his wife, and went to Portsmouth with him."

Joseph married Joanna UNKNOWN in 1659 in Portsmouth, Newport Co, RI. (Joanna UNKNOWN was born about 1635 and died after 1669.)
